One moment, Alex was comfortably seated in his room, controller in hand, immersed in the virtual world of Elfera. The next, a wave of darkness washed over him. When he opened his eyes, he was standing in a lush, green forest, in the body of his video game avatar, a female elf warrior.

Alex looked down at his new body. He had a delicate face with piercing green eyes, long fiery red hair tied in a tight bun, and a short dress hugging his slender frame. He was now an elf warrior, a girl.

Alex decided to embrace this change rather than panic. He spent the next day adjusting to his new body. He explored the possibilities of different hairstyles and outfits, finally settling on a ponytail and a comfortable tunic.

Once he felt ready, Alex ventured into the village. The villagers, unaware of his transformation, greeted him warmly. He returned their smiles, suddenly realizing how easy it was to adapt to this new life.

Days turned into weeks. Alex mastered the art of archery and swordsmanship, building a reputation as a fierce warrior. His courage and bravery were admired by all, earning him respect and admiration.

One day, a villager named Elin approached him. Elin was a skilled blacksmith, known for her strength and kind heart. She offered to train Alex, seeing potential in the young warrior.

Alex gratefully accepted her offer. Under Elin's guidance, he honed his skills, becoming an even more formidable warrior. He appreciated not just the training but also the friendship that developed between them.

As time passed, Alex found himself completely immersed in the life of an elf warrior. He started to forget his past as a human boy. The game, Elfera, became his reality.

A threat soon loomed over the village. A dragon, known as Infernus, was terrorizing the villagers. It was said that only a powerful warrior could defeat it. Alex knew what he had to do.

Alex, armed with a sword forged by Elin, faced the dragon. It was a fierce battle, but Alex held his ground. His determination and courage shone through, inspiring the villagers.

With a final, powerful swing, Alex struck the dragon down. The villagers cheered, their joy echoing through the forest. Alex, their savior, was hailed as a hero.

Alex felt a wave of pride and happiness wash over him. He had not only survived as a female elf warrior but also thrived. He had found a home in Elfera and a family among the villagers.

One day, while Alex was practicing with Elin, a strange sensation swept over him. His vision blurred, and he felt a pull towards his own world. He knew his time in Elfera was coming to an end.

Alex said a heartfelt goodbye to Elin and the villagers. Tears welled up in his eyes as he watched the world he had come to love fade away. He found himself back in his room, controller in hand.

Alex looked at the screen displaying the world of Elfera. His heart ached with longing. He had left a part of himself there, in the form of a courageous elf warrior.

He realized he had not just been playing a game; he had been living a life. A life that had taught him courage, friendship, and acceptance. A life he would always cherish.

As Alex reflected on his experience, he felt a newfound sense of self. He had embraced a new identity and thrived. It was a journey he would always remember, the transformation of a boy into an Elven Warrior.

Alex picked up the controller once more. He was not just playing a game anymore; he was visiting a world where he had fought, lived, and loved. He smiled, ready for another adventure in Elfera.
